Evolution of Dating Apps
Dating apps have come a long way since the early days of Tinder, which revolutionized the industry with its simple swipe mechanism. This intuitive feature made finding matches fast and engaging, setting a standard that many apps would later follow.
As the market evolved, platforms began catering to different needs and preferences. Bumble introduced a game-changing twist by allowing only women to start conversations in heterosexual matches, empowering users and addressing concerns around online harassment. Meanwhile, Hinge focuses on fostering meaningful connections, encouraging detailed profiles and thoughtful prompts that promote genuine interaction before a match is made.
From quick swipes to intentional conversations, dating apps have continuously adapted to create experiences that suit a variety of dating goals, making online dating more personalized and purposeful than ever.

Unique Features of Tinder
At the heart of Tinder’s popularity is its iconic swipe mechanic. Swiping right to express interest and left to pass allows users to make quick decisions with minimal effort, creating a smooth and intuitive dating flow. This simplicity is one of Tinder’s biggest strengths, especially for users who prefer instant interactions.
Tinder also enhances profile authenticity through social media integration, originally linking profiles to Facebook to display photos, shared interests, and mutual connections. Over time, the platform expanded its feature set to include options such as Super Likes, which let users signal stronger interest, and Passport, a location-based feature that allows connections with people around the world. These tools not only increase engagement but also significantly broaden users’ dating opportunities, making Tinder both flexible and globally accessible.

User Experience Insights
Tinder’s user experience is built around speed, simplicity, and instant gratification. The app is easy to navigate, with a quick sign-up process that allows users to connect their social media accounts and start swiping within minutes. This low entry barrier makes Tinder especially appealing to new users.
The swipe mechanic and immediate match notifications create a fast feedback loop that keeps users engaged and encourages frequent returns. While this gamified system is entertaining, it can also shift the focus away from building meaningful connections and toward quick judgments based on appearance.
One of Tinder’s stronger points is its chat system, which only becomes available after a mutual match. This adds a layer of security and makes conversations feel more intentional, reducing the likelihood of unwanted messages. Overall, Tinder delivers a highly engaging, efficient experience — ideal for users who value speed and convenience, but less suited to those seeking deeper, more thoughtful interactions.

Bumble's Unique Approach
Bumble distinguishes itself by implementing a unique female-first initiative where only women can initiate conversations in heterosexual matches. This design dramatically shifts the dynamics commonly seen in dating apps, creating an environment that prioritizes female empowerment and safety. By allowing women to take the first step, Bumble addresses concerns about unwanted messages and promotes a more respectful and considerate dating experience. Furthermore, Bumble extends its reach beyond dating with features such as Bumble BFF and Bumble Bizz, which facilitate platonic friendships and professional networking, respectively. This multi-faceted approach underscores Bumble's commitment to fostering diverse types of connections.
Comparing Bumble to Tinder
While both Bumble and Tinder rely on the swipe mechanic for matching, their core philosophies diverge significantly. Tinder, as a pioneer, has always emphasized quick and expansive matchmaking but often highlights casual connections. In contrast, Bumble centers its platform around safety and respect, encouraging users to engage in meaningful conversations. Bumble's time-sensitive connection rules, which require conversations to start within 24 hours, add a layer of urgency to its interactions. Additionally, the emphasis on allowing women to initiate contact distinguishes Bumble from Tinder, catering to users seeking more control over their online dating experience.

Hinge's Matchmaking Process
Hinge's matchmaking process is centered around quality interactions rather than quantity. The app encourages users to present a more complete portrait of themselves by answering specific prompts and showcasing diverse aspects of their personality and interests. This comprehensive approach is designed to facilitate deeper connections right from the start. Unlike the endless stream of profiles on other apps, Hinge provides daily recommendations based on users' preferences and behavior, refining matches over time. The emphasis is not only on swiping but also on engaging with specific aspects of a user's profile, which promotes thoughtful interactions and significantly enhances dating success.
Advantages Over Competitors
Hinge distinguishes itself from competitors through several key advantages. Firstly, Hinge's interface emphasizes depth and substance over superficial swiping, appealing to users searching for lasting relationships. The app's curated profile prompts allow users to express individuality, facilitating more authentic connections. Additionally, Hinge's algorithm prioritizes dealbreakers, ensuring users are matched only with others who meet their core criteria, reducing mismatches and frustration. Unlike its counterparts, Hinge places great value on user feedback, using this data to continuously refine the matchmaking process and improve user satisfaction. Together, these advantages make Hinge a compelling choice for those invested in serious dating.
